right-shift operator

Generics の文法を標準 C++ のテンプレートと似せて <T> としたため、C++ 同様に右シフト演算子(>>)と2重になった Typed-parameter(List<Nullable<int>>)の終端を区別する必要ができました。
このため、文法定義に right-shift と right-shift-assignment が追加され、operator-or-punctuator から >> と >>= は削除されました。
標準 C++ のテンプレート同様に、

  List< Nullable >

と、2つ続く > の間に空白を挿入することで回避できます。また、追加された右シフトの演算子とは説明文に「間に空白すら挟むことができない」と追記されているだけで C# 1.2 のものとまったく同じです。
構文に修正が入っているので Java 同様に <T<T>> がシフト演算子と間違われることは少ないと思われます。
# 日記登録時は誤訳してました。実動作チェックして修正しました、すいません。